MLB has a massive pace of play issue, and it isn't getting better, no matter what rule changes the sport introduces. In 2020, the average game lasted 3:07. In 2019, that number was 3:05. Going back to 2015, that number was 2:57.

According to Baseball-Reference, the average length of a Cincinnati Reds game in 2021 is THREE HOURS AND SEVENTEEN MINUTES. That's the average! The Dodgers and Padres lead the league with average games that last 3:18.
